SSMS
 sql >> Teknologi Basis Data >  >> Database Tools >> SSMS

Bagaimana cara menentukan tipe data dari hasil SQL?

Anda mungkin menggunakan beberapa pernyataan SQL cepat untuk melihat jenis kolom hasil, dengan menggunakan tabel temp.

Tabel sementara sedikit lebih baik daripada tampilan, karena merupakan lingkup koneksi-lokal dan akan dihapus setelah diputuskan.

Yang Anda butuhkan hanyalah menyuntikkan beberapa kata kunci sebagai berikut

SELECT
TOP 0 -- to speed up without access data
your,original,columns
INTO #T -- temp table magic
FROM originalTablesJoins
Order by anything
exec tempdb.sys.sp_columns #T
drop table #T

atau;

SELECT TOP 0 *
INTO #T
FROM (
  select your,original,columns from originalTablesJoins -- remove order by if any
) x
exec tempdb.sys.sp_columns #T
drop table #T

Catatan:terinspirasi olehLihat skema hasil di SQL Server Management Studio



  1. DBeaver
  2.   
  3. phpMyAdmin
  4.   
  5. Navicat
  6.   
  7. SSMS
  8.   
  9. MySQL Workbench
  10.   
  11. SQLyog
  1. Database dan Pengembangan Kode yang Lebih Aman dan Produktif di SQL yang Diperbarui Lengkap

  2. Apakah ada Add-in Pelengkapan Otomatis SQL Server Mgmt Studio Gratis?

  3. Mengapa menjalankan kueri pada SQL Azure jauh lebih lambat?

  4. Tidak Dapat Terhubung ke Plesk v12 SQL Server dari Jarak Jauh dari SQL Server Management Studio

  5. Aplikasi dapat membuka .mdf tanpa file log tetapi Management Studio tidak dapat melampirkan